Fire Damages Madison Apartment Building

Some residents of a Madison apartment building are out in the heat after a fire forces them out of their home.

A call to the 2400 block of Fish Hatchery Road came in just after 7:30 p.m. Wednesday.

When they arrived, firefighters say they found heavy smoke coming from the second floor.

Crews were able to knock the fire out in about five minutes. Fire officials say the hot temps help them move fast.

Damage is estimated at $15,000, and was contained to a bedroom, bathroom, and closet in one apartment of the eight unit building.

No one was injured. The cause of the fire remains under investigation.
